Bant Nadu (49 gamers): Bant Nadu is a brand-new combo technique that tries to assemble Nadu, Winged Knowledge and Shuko. Shuko targets your creatures for zero mana, permitting Nadu’s skill to occur set off for every creature you management. This yields numerous free playing cards. Every land put onto the battlefield by Nadu enters untapped and triggers Springheart Nantuko, creating one other 1/1 creature that may get focused by Shuko twice. When you get going, you may simply draw your total deck. You may even play a recent Nadu to reset the “twice per flip” counter alongside the way in which. Ultimately, you will use Thassa’s Oracle or a convoluted Endurance loop to win the sport.
Ruby Storm (23 gamers): Ruby Storm is a brand new combo technique primarily based round Ruby Medallion and Ral, Monsoon Mage from Trendy Horizons 3. With both of those playing cards on the battlefield, Pyretic Ritual and Determined Ritual price just one mana and add three, unlocking an enormous mana enhance. The price of Reckless Impulse and Wrenn’s Resolve can be decreased, permitting you to quickly sift by way of your deck. The plan is to forged quite a few spells in a single flip at a decreased price, do it once more with Previous in Flames, and end the job with a deadly Grapeshot.
Jeskai Management (22 gamers): Jeskai Management options spot removing, countermagic, card draw, sweepers, and the highly effective new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ury to stabilize and win the sport. The deck additionally exploits an power package deal from Trendy Horizons 3 with Tune the Narrative, Galvanic Discharge, and Wrath of the Skies. The characteristic that distinguishes Jeskai Management from different Jeskai decks is that it makes use of not less than three copies of The One Ring or Reminiscence Deluge to web card benefit and help its management plan.
Mono-Black Necro (17 gamers): Mono-Black Necro options low-cost, environment friendly interplay to commerce assets within the early turns earlier than refilling with Necrodominance. Not like the unique Necropotence, this new enchantment truly attracts the playing cards, so you may nearly double your life whole with Sheoldred, the Apocalypse whereas sculpting the proper five-card hand. There’s additionally a possibility to forged spells in between drawing playing cards and discarding handy dimension, so you may pay an exorbitant quantity of life, pitch a great deal of playing cards to March of Wretched Sorrow or Soul Spike, and move the flip at a better life whole than you began with.
Eldrazi Tron (14 gamers): Eldrazi Tron exploits Ugin’s Labyrinth from Trendy Horizons 3, which might imprint Devourer of Future or All Is Mud to get entry to 2 mana on flip one. Together with Eldrazi Temple and the trio of Urza lands, this deck ramps into huge quantities of colorless mana early on. All Eldrazi Tron decks sink their mana into Karn, the Nice Creator; The One Ring; and Kozilek’s Command.
4-Coloration Nadu (13 gamers): 4-Coloration Nadu is mainly Bant Nadu splashing for Orcish Bowmasters or Thoughtseize. Fascinatingly, many Nadu, Winged Knowledge decks on the Professional Tour have shaved Thassa’s Oracle and are as a substitute using Endurance loops as their win situation. Those in 4-Coloration Nadu are best to clarify. In case your library consists of 4 lands whilst you bestowed Springheart Nantuko onto each Endurance and Orcish Bowmasters, then you may goal 4 Insect tokens with Shuko, use the 4 lands to create copies of Orcish Bowmasters and Endurance, sacrifice them to Sylvan Safekeeper, and have Endurance return them to your library. You may loop to create infinite Orcish Bowmasters copies to deal infinite harm.
Boros Power (13 gamers): Boros Power is a midrange deck that makes the a lot of the power mechanic introduced again in Trendy Horizons 3, combining playing cards like Information of Souls, Amped Raptor, Galvanic Discharge, Unstable Amulet, and Static Jail. With this highly effective suite of playing cards, you may all the time spend power on probably the most fruitful manner attainable for the sport at hand, whereas the early-drop creatures put appreciable stress on the opponent.
Jeskai Wizards (12 gamers): Like Jeskai Management, Jeskai Wizards options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ury together with the power package deal of Tune the Narrative, Galvanic Discharge, and Wrath of the Skies. The characteristic that distinguishes Jeskai Wizards from different Jeskai decks is that it runs Tamiyo, Inquisitive Pupil and Snapcaster Mage to allow Flame of Anor. On flip 4, you would forged Tamiyo and instantly rework her right into a planeswalker type by drawing playing cards with Flame of Anor, which is a strong line of play. In her planeswalker type, Tamiyo has a strong defensive skill and an easy-to-reach, game-winning final.
Mono-Black Grief (6 gamers): The dream for Mono-Black Grief is to evoke Grief on flip one, discard the opponent’s Galvanic Discharge with the evoke set off nonetheless on the stack, and return it with Not Useless After All. Roughly one in each seven of the deck’s opening arms are able to this dreaded sequence, and it leads to a 4/3 menace with one other discard set off connected. A brand new addition to the technique from Trendy Horizons 3 is Nethergoyf, which grows when Mishra‘s Bauble or Urza’s Saga hit the graveyard.
Jeskai Costume Down (6 gamers): Jeskai Costume Down is much like Jeskai Management and Jeskai Wizards, nevertheless it stands out as a result of it makes use of not less than three copies of Costume Down alongside a number of copies of Nulldrifter. Costume Down makes it so that you just will not should sacrifice a three-mana Phlage or Nulldrifter, permitting you to construct an unlimited risk at a decreased price. Alternatively, the sacrifice set off could be countered by Consign to Reminiscence, so Nulldrifter can constantly annihilate opponents early on.
Gruul Eldrazi (6 gamers): Gruul Eldrazi leverages Eldrazi Temple and Ugin’s Labyrinth, much like Eldrazi Tron, for a fast mana enhance, ramping into highly effective mid-game Eldrazi and top-end spells. The killing blow in addition to the deck’s distinctive twist is to make use of By way of the Breach to sneak in Emrakul, the Aeons Torn; which is able to assault with annihilator 6.
On the entire, the Professional Tour metagame is dominated by combo methods. Final week, in my evaluation of the primary Magic On-line occasions after Trendy Horizons 3, Ruby Storm and Bant Nadu already gave the impression to be very promising. After an extra week of testing, these two decks are on high of the Professional Tour metagame. Between Bant, 4-Coloration, and Devoted Nadu, practically 26% of the sphere will attempt to assemble the combo of Nadu, Winged Knowledge and Shuko. With Ruby Storm and different combo methods additionally being well-represented, many video games on the Professional Tour would possibly finish as early as flip three.
Nevertheless, Trendy has been evolving quickly. For instance, established archetypes akin to Dwelling Finish fell by the wayside as gamers tried to interrupt the brand new playing cards. In the meantime, new archetypes like Mono-Black Necro rose in prominence. However the largest growth is the emergence of a big number of Boros, Jeskai, and Mardu decks that exploit the brand new power playing cards from Trendy Horizons 3 together with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ury. Practically 25% of the sphere registered certainly one of these decks, which is nearly as a lot because the Nadu contingent. When it comes to uncooked card rely, an important new additions are Galvanic Discharge and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ury. Each playing cards have discovered their manner into decks like Jeskai Management, Boros Power, Jeskai Wizards, Jeskai Costume Down, Mardu Power, and varied others. As well as, many Ruby Storm decks use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ury of their sideboard to deal with Drannith Justice of the Peace and to supply an alternate path to victory. On the similar time, varied Gruul Prowess decks have adopted Galvanic Discharge as properly.
Galvanic Discharge is the most-played new power card general. It is mainly a Lightning Bolt for creatures or planeswalkers with extra flexibility. When mixed with different power playing cards, it turns into much like Unholy Warmth in its skill to take down huge creatures. And when it burns a smaller creature, you may retailer the power for Wrath of the Skies afterward. But many Professional Tour rivals anticipated this development, as Suncleanser began to seem as a spicy reply that may stop opponents from accumulating power counters.
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ury is a twist on Uro, Titan of Nature’s Wrath and Kroxa, Titan of Dying’s Starvation. Uro is at present banned in Trendy, and Kroxa received Professional Tour The Lord of the Rings final yr, so there’s some main historic pedigree. In comparison with Kroxa’s two-mana discard impact, Phlage’s entrance facet of a three-mana Lightning Helix is usually higher. It stabilizes the board, extends the sport, and could be escaped to dominate the battlefield and subsequent harm race.

Nadu, Winged Knowledge has enabled a brand-new combo technique that is going to be a transparent front-runner on the Professional Tour. By itself, Nadu is a 3/4 flier that does not die to Lightning Bolt and that attracts you a card when your opponent tries to kill it. But when mixed with methods to focus on your individual creatures for zero mana, akin to Shuko or Outrider en-Kor, you may go off and win the sport on the spot. As a consequence of its wording, Nadu’s skill applies twice for every creature you management, not twice in whole, so each creature you management will successfully yields two free playing cards, placing any lands onto the battlefield untapped.
Springheart Nantuko is Nadu’s associate in crime. When it is on the battlefield, each land hit by Nadu creates a 1/1 Insect token, permitting you to maintain the chain going and mainly by no means run out of creatures to focus on. Bestowing it onto creatures can doubtlessly present extra worth as properly, and several other gamers on the Professional Tour plan to create infinite copies of Arboreal Grazer by combining a bestowed Arboreal Grazer with Amulet of Vigor and Simic Development Chamber.

Power playing cards get higher the extra you’ve got of them. Working a number of power sources let you spend your power assets in the easiest way for the sport at hand. Whereas Galvanic Discharge is the most-played power card, Wrath of the Skies, Tune the Narrative, Static Jail, Amped Raptor, Unstable Amulet, and Information of Souls from Trendy Horizons 3 are seeing appreciable play as properly.
Wrath of the Skies particularly gives Jeskai decks with an inexpensive sweeper impact that is devastating towards any technique counting on growing a giant board state. It additionally traces up notably properly towards Urza’s Saga. Because of this, Wrath of the Skies is a superb reply to Bant Nadu. Furthermore, curving Tune the Narrative into Wrath of the Skies means that you’ve got sufficient power for an enormous sweeper, at the same time as early as flip two or three.
Static Jail, Amped Raptor, Unstable Amulet, and Information of Souls aren’t typically seen in Jeskai decks, however they’re recurrently included in Boros Power and Mardu Power decks. Static Jail can be a well-liked sideboard card for Ruby Storm decks, permitting them to reply playing cards like Damping Sphere for a single mana.

Ral, Monsoon Mage and Ruby Medallion are additionally excessive on the listing of most-played Trendy Horizons 3 playing cards. They’re present in just one archetype—Ruby Storm—however they’re important four-of’s in that deck. By combining these cost-reducing two-drops with playing cards Pyretic Ritual and Reckless Impulse, this combo technique can win on flip three.

The ultimate set of playing cards that I’dlike to focus on are the assorted new Eldrazi playing cards. Devourer of Future and Ugin’s Labyrinth can present a land that faucets for 2 mana, which you’ll sink into an unlimited Kozilek’s Command. These playing cards have enabled novel Eldrazi Tron, Gruul Eldrazi, and Temur Eldrazi builds. All of them play a bit otherwise—Eldrazi Tron builds up a great deal of mana; Gruul Eldrazi exploits By way of the Breach; and Temur Eldrazi is extra aggressive in nature—however all of them showcase the ability of the all-devouring Eldrazi.
Partly as a result of prominence of Devourer of Future, Consign to Reminiscence has change into a highly regarded sideboard inclusion, as it may counter each an Eldrazi and its forged set off. It additionally solutions The One Ring or stifles your individual sacrifice set off from Phlage, Titan of Hearth’s Fury, so it has loads of utility. In actual fact, it is the most-played sideboard card from Trendy Horizons 3, exhibiting that there many appropriate solutions to all the brand new threats.
